国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

RTC與WebRTC的主要區別

科技綠洲 ? 來源:網絡整理 ? 作者:網絡整理 ? 2024-12-11 15:41 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

在數字通信領域,實時通信(RTC)和WebRTC是兩個經常被提及的術語。它們都旨在提供即時的、高質量的通信體驗,但它們在實現方式、應用場景和技術支持上有所不同。

1. 定義與起源

1.1 實時通信(RTC)

實時通信(RTC)是一個廣泛的術語,涵蓋了所有能夠實現實時數據傳輸的技術。這包括語音、視頻、消息和文件傳輸等多種通信形式。RTC可以應用于多種平臺和設備,包括桌面計算機、移動設備和嵌入式系統。RTC的實現方式多種多樣,可以基于各種協議和標準,如SIP、RTP、H.323等。

1.2 WebRTC(Web Real-Time Communication)

WebRTC是一個開源項目,旨在使網頁瀏覽器能夠進行實時通信,而無需安裝任何插件或第三方軟件。它是基于IETF的RFC協議開發的,包括了一套API和協議,使得開發者能夠在網頁應用中輕松實現音視頻通話、文件共享等功能。WebRTC的核心是P2P(點對點)連接,這意味著通信雙方可以直接連接,無需通過中央服務器,從而減少延遲和提高通信效率。

2. 技術實現

2.1 RTC的技術實現

RTC的技術實現可以非常多樣化,因為它不局限于特定的協議或平臺。例如,一些RTC解決方案可能使用SIP協議進行語音通信,而其他解決方案可能使用RTP/RTCP進行視頻通信。RTC解決方案通常需要專門的客戶端軟件或硬件設備,以支持特定的通信協議和功能。

2.2 WebRTC的技術實現

WebRTC的技術實現相對統一,因為它基于一套標準化的API和協議。WebRTC的核心組件包括:

  • STUN/TURN服務器 :用于NAT穿透,幫助在不同網絡環境下建立P2P連接。
  • SDP(會話描述協議) :用于在通信雙方之間交換媒體和網絡信息。
  • ICE(交互式連接建立) :用于在多種網絡條件下建立最佳連接路徑。
  • DTLS/SRTP :用于加密通信,保護數據傳輸的安全。

WebRTC的這些組件共同工作,使得開發者可以在網頁瀏覽器中實現實時通信功能。

3. 應用場景

3.1 RTC的應用場景

RTC的應用場景非常廣泛,包括但不限于:

  • 企業通信 :如IP電話系統、視頻會議系統等。
  • 社交網絡 :如即時消息、語音和視頻聊天功能。
  • 在線教育 :如遠程教學和在線輔導。
  • 緊急服務 :如緊急呼叫和遠程醫療咨詢。

3.2 WebRTC的應用場景

WebRTC的應用場景主要集中在基于網頁的應用中,例如:

  • 網頁聊天應用 :如在線客服、即時消息服務。
  • 視頻會議 :如遠程工作和在線會議。
  • 在線游戲 :如多人在線游戲的實時語音通信。
  • 遠程醫療 :如在線咨詢和遠程診斷。

4. 優勢與限制

4.1 RTC的優勢與限制

優勢

  • 靈活性 :RTC解決方案可以根據特定需求進行定制。
  • 兼容性 :RTC可以支持多種設備和平臺。
  • 成熟性 :RTC技術已經發展多年,擁有成熟的解決方案和廣泛的支持。

限制

  • 設備依賴 :RTC可能需要特定的硬件或軟件支持。
  • 網絡依賴 :RTC的性能可能受到網絡條件的限制。

4.2 WebRTC的優勢與限制

優勢

  • 無需插件 :WebRTC無需安裝任何插件即可在瀏覽器中工作。
  • 跨平臺 :WebRTC支持所有主流瀏覽器和操作系統
  • P2P連接 :WebRTC的P2P連接減少了服務器負載,提高了通信效率。

限制

  • 瀏覽器支持 :雖然大多數現代瀏覽器都支持WebRTC,但仍有一些舊版本或小眾瀏覽器不支持。
  • 移動設備支持 :雖然WebRTC在桌面瀏覽器中得到了很好的支持,但在移動設備上的實現可能存在差異。

5. 結論

RTC和WebRTC都是實現實時通信的重要技術,它們各自有不同的優勢和應用場景。RTC提供了廣泛的靈活性和兼容性,適用于多種設備和平臺,而WebRTC則以其無需插件、跨平臺和P2P連接的優勢,在基于網頁的應用中發揮著重要作用。隨著技術的發展,這兩種技術也在不斷融合和演進,為用戶提供更加豐富和便捷的實時通信體驗。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 數字通信
    +關注

    關注

    1

    文章

    151

    瀏覽量

    23286
  • 瀏覽器
    +關注

    關注

    1

    文章

    1043

    瀏覽量

    37076
  • RTC
    RTC
    +關注

    關注

    2

    文章

    653

    瀏覽量

    71793
  • WebRTC
    +關注

    關注

    0

    文章

    57

    瀏覽量

    11942
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    淺談愛普生RTC模塊的特點與用途

    實時時鐘(RTC)在眾多需要精確計時的應用中起著不可或缺的作用,而RTC又不僅僅只是一個用來計時的電子元器件。在以下文章中,將介紹實時時鐘(RTC)與RTC模塊,同時了解愛普生的
    的頭像 發表于 01-04 09:16 ?639次閱讀
    淺談愛普生<b class='flag-5'>RTC</b>模塊的特點與用途

    ADI GMSL技術兩種視頻數據傳輸模式的區別

    本文深入介紹GMSL技術,重點說明用于視頻數據傳輸的像素模式和隧道模式之間的差異。文章將闡明這兩種模式之間的主要區別,并探討成功實施需要注意的具體事項。
    的頭像 發表于 10-10 13:49 ?2319次閱讀
    ADI GMSL技術兩種視頻數據傳輸模式的<b class='flag-5'>區別</b>

    科普 | WebRTC開發調度臺如何拉取視頻監控畫面

    目前很多的融合通信,應急指揮項目使用WebRTC方式開發調度臺的操控界面,由于WebRTC的實時通信能力和豐富的開源社區支持能力,使用WebRTC在應急指揮,融合通信方面具有天然的優勢。可以快速實現
    的頭像 發表于 09-25 16:32 ?770次閱讀
    科普 | <b class='flag-5'>WebRTC</b>開發調度臺如何拉取視頻監控畫面

    AT32的ERTC與RTC區別

    AT32單片機系列中包含兩種實時時鐘(RTC)模塊:標準的RTC和增強型RTC(ERTC)。以下是兩者的區別: 功能豐富性 RTC :提供基
    發表于 07-11 10:48

    伺服系統和單片機有什么區別

    伺服系統和單片機是兩類完全不同的技術,主要區別體現在功能定位、工作原理、應用場景等方面。
    的頭像 發表于 06-28 15:21 ?671次閱讀

    圖像采集卡與視頻采集卡的主要區別對比

    圖像采集卡和視頻采集卡的核心區別在于它們的設計目標、處理對象和典型應用場景。盡管名稱相似,且有時功能會有重疊(尤其是高端設備),但它們側重點不同:以下是主要區別:1.處理對象與目標圖像采集卡:主要
    的頭像 發表于 06-27 14:42 ?971次閱讀
    圖像采集卡與視頻采集卡的<b class='flag-5'>主要區別</b>對比

    WSL 1 和 WSL 2 的區別是什么

    PS C:\Users\Administrator> wsl --set-default-version 2 >> 有關與 WSL 2 的主要區別的信息,請訪問 https://aka.ms/wsl2
    的頭像 發表于 06-27 10:25 ?2358次閱讀

    傳統藍牙與低功耗藍牙主要區別

    傳統藍牙即經典藍牙,能夠實現音頻傳輸,可傳輸較大文件,功耗較大;BLE藍牙即低功耗藍牙,僅支持數據傳輸,只適合做短距離的數據采集,數據傳輸及物聯網智能控制等。
    發表于 06-18 16:04

    “耐高溫!”RTC時鐘芯片+電池的應用案例(二)

    實時時鐘,簡稱RTC,是廣泛應用于電子產品的重要元器件。愛普生RTC實時時鐘具有高精度、高穩定性和多功能等特點,廣泛應用于多個行業。RTC時鐘芯片主要功能是保持設備時間的準確運行,即使
    的頭像 發表于 06-04 17:35 ?1745次閱讀
    “耐高溫!”<b class='flag-5'>RTC</b>時鐘芯片+電池的應用案例(二)

    差分晶體振蕩器和單端振蕩器在輸出模式有什么區別

    差分晶振和單端晶振的主要區別在于輸出信號類型、抗干擾能力、應用場景以及封裝形式等方面。?
    的頭像 發表于 06-04 09:29 ?891次閱讀

    CCG3PA系列與CCG7D系列的主要區別是什么?

    1、我想了解一下CCG3PA系列與CCG7D系列的主要區別有哪些,有沒有相關對照表參考。 2、我看了相關資料兩款芯片都支持后座娛樂系統,這樣的話,如果客戶在功率方面要求較低的情況下,更傾向于選擇
    發表于 05-30 07:25

    基于RK3576開發板的RTC使用說明

    文章主要展示RK3576開發板的RTC信息和快速上手例程
    的頭像 發表于 05-07 15:04 ?2228次閱讀
    基于RK3576開發板的<b class='flag-5'>RTC</b>使用說明

    變壓器和自耦變壓器的區別?一篇文章讓你輕松弄懂!

    變壓器和自耦變壓器的主要區別在于它們的結構、性能和使用范圍,以下是變壓器生產廠家小編提供的相關介紹:
    的頭像 發表于 04-29 15:29 ?1305次閱讀

    固晶錫膏與常規SMT錫膏有哪些區別

    固晶錫膏與常規SMT錫膏在電子制造中分別用于不同工藝環節,主要區別體現在以下方面:
    的頭像 發表于 04-18 09:14 ?725次閱讀
    固晶錫膏與常規SMT錫膏有哪些<b class='flag-5'>區別</b>?

    小安派BW21-CBV-Kit教程——基礎RTC例程與簡易RTC鬧鐘

    本例演示如何使用 RTC 庫方法。本函數介紹如何使用 RTC API。RTC 功能由一個獨立的 BCD 定時器/計數器實現。
    發表于 04-13 17:46 ?723次閱讀
    小安派BW21-CBV-Kit教程——基礎<b class='flag-5'>RTC</b>例程與簡易<b class='flag-5'>RTC</b>鬧鐘